Frequently Asked Questions about Richmond
How much are Studio apartments in Richmond?
There are currently 529 Studio Apartments in Richmond with rent ranges from $1,395 to $2,997 with an average price of $2,090.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Richmond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Richmond ranges from $1,195 to $8,981 with an average monthly rent of $2,293.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Richmond c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Richmond range from $1,750 to $10,893.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,803.
How expensive are Richmond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 274 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Richmond on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,000 to $13,127 - averaging $3,794 for the location.
